DigiPak Draft Feedback


  • Add and include a list of of songs that are part of the album. 
  • Replace black background with something more interesting and appealing.
  • A lot of our target audience didn't really like the images that we chose for the inside covers. Think about taking new pictures but with the same theme. 
  • Stick to one colour scheme, make the front cover's colour scheme match with the back and inside covers. 
  • A lot of our target audience really liked the image for the front cover so possibly use the same concept and idea for the other images. 
  • Use a more unique and eye catching font for the title of the album.

DigiPak Draft #1


The image above is our first idea for our DigiPak. The top right image will be the front cover while the top left will be be the back cover with the bottom photos being the inisde cover. We decided to use the silhouette image for the front cover as we really like the idea and theme behind it. It also matches very well with the music video as the video also consists of a lot of silhouette shots. The location of all the images also links to the music video in that it is the same church that we used to film the intro. We decided not to show the artist's face as a way to challenge certain conventions of hip pop DigiPaks as usually hip pop artists like to have the face and image be the main focus while for our one the artist wanted to keep his identity hidden for the cover. Lastly we also decided to use a black and white them for some of the images to add an aesthetic look to our design.

Filming Day #4 Reflections

On the last day of filming we decided to go out to the top of the car park in Harrow. Here our primary goal was to really get a nice shot and view of the skyline, and our artist performing with the city lights being the background. Overall I feel it was a very successful day as we got a lot of long and mid shots of our artist with the view behind him. This really made for an interesting set of shots and I feel will really add to our music video. On the day there really wasn't any problems and everything ran very smoothly. We took the precautions we needed too, specially since we were up so high. All in all I feel like this was one of the most successful days out of the lot as it provided as with a variety of possible openings for the main verses of the song and generally just went very smoothly.
